Message ID | 8602f414ccdbf2ed803b013cdb7b9a97739d4921.1647006877.git.mchehab@kernel.org (mailing list archive) |
---|---|
State | Not Applicable, archived |
Headers | show |
Series | Sort Makefiles and platform/Kconfig | expand |
On Fri, 11 Mar 2022 at 15:09, Mauro Carvalho Chehab <mchehab@kernel.org> wrote: > > In order to better organize the platform/Kconfig, place > camss-specific config stuff on a separate Kconfig file. > > Signed-off-by: Mauro Carvalho Chehab <mchehab@kernel.org> > Signed-off-by: Mauro Carvalho Chehab <mchehab@kernel.org> > --- > > To avoid mailbombing on a large number of people, only mailing lists were C/C on the cover. > See [PATCH v2 00/38] at: https://lore.kernel.org/all/cover.1647006877.git.mchehab@kernel.org/ > > drivers/media/platform/Kconfig | 11 +---------- > drivers/media/platform/qcom/camss/Kconfig | 9 +++++++++ > 2 files changed, 10 insertions(+), 10 deletions(-) > create mode 100644 drivers/media/platform/qcom/camss/Kconfig > > diff --git a/drivers/media/platform/Kconfig b/drivers/media/platform/Kconfig > index f65eefa15dda..19ca01d2f841 100644 > --- a/drivers/media/platform/Kconfig > +++ b/drivers/media/platform/Kconfig > @@ -61,6 +61,7 @@ source "drivers/media/platform/mtk-vcodec/Kconfig" > source "drivers/media/platform/mtk-vpu/Kconfig" > source "drivers/media/platform/omap3isp/Kconfig" > source "drivers/media/platform/omap/Kconfig" > +source "drivers/media/platform/qcom/camss/Kconfig" > > source "drivers/media/platform/aspeed/Kconfig" > > @@ -78,16 +79,6 @@ config VIDEO_MUX > > source "drivers/media/platform/intel/Kconfig" > > -config VIDEO_QCOM_CAMSS > - tristate "Qualcomm V4L2 Camera Subsystem driver" > - depends on V4L_PLATFORM_DRIVERS > - depends on VIDEO_V4L2 > - depends on (ARCH_QCOM && IOMMU_DMA) || COMPILE_TEST > - select MEDIA_CONTROLLER > - select VIDEO_V4L2_SUBDEV_API > - select VIDEOBUF2_DMA_SG > - select V4L2_FWNODE > - > config VIDEO_S3C_CAMIF > tristate "Samsung S3C24XX/S3C64XX SoC Camera Interface driver" > depends on V4L_PLATFORM_DRIVERS > diff --git a/drivers/media/platform/qcom/camss/Kconfig b/drivers/media/platform/qcom/camss/Kconfig > new file mode 100644 > index 000000000000..56be91578706 > --- /dev/null > +++ b/drivers/media/platform/qcom/camss/Kconfig > @@ -0,0 +1,9 @@ > +config VIDEO_QCOM_CAMSS > + tristate "Qualcomm V4L2 Camera Subsystem driver" > + depends on V4L_PLATFORM_DRIVERS > + depends on VIDEO_V4L2 > + depends on (ARCH_QCOM && IOMMU_DMA) || COMPILE_TEST > + select MEDIA_CONTROLLER > + select VIDEO_V4L2_SUBDEV_API > + select VIDEOBUF2_DMA_SG > + select V4L2_FWNODE > -- > 2.35.1 > Reviewed-by: Robert Foss <robert.foss@linaro.org>
diff --git a/drivers/media/platform/Kconfig b/drivers/media/platform/Kconfig index f65eefa15dda..19ca01d2f841 100644 --- a/drivers/media/platform/Kconfig +++ b/drivers/media/platform/Kconfig @@ -61,6 +61,7 @@ source "drivers/media/platform/mtk-vcodec/Kconfig" source "drivers/media/platform/mtk-vpu/Kconfig" source "drivers/media/platform/omap3isp/Kconfig" source "drivers/media/platform/omap/Kconfig" +source "drivers/media/platform/qcom/camss/Kconfig" source "drivers/media/platform/aspeed/Kconfig" @@ -78,16 +79,6 @@ config VIDEO_MUX source "drivers/media/platform/intel/Kconfig" -config VIDEO_QCOM_CAMSS - tristate "Qualcomm V4L2 Camera Subsystem driver" - depends on V4L_PLATFORM_DRIVERS - depends on VIDEO_V4L2 - depends on (ARCH_QCOM && IOMMU_DMA) || COMPILE_TEST - select MEDIA_CONTROLLER - select VIDEO_V4L2_SUBDEV_API - select VIDEOBUF2_DMA_SG - select V4L2_FWNODE - config VIDEO_S3C_CAMIF tristate "Samsung S3C24XX/S3C64XX SoC Camera Interface driver" depends on V4L_PLATFORM_DRIVERS diff --git a/drivers/media/platform/qcom/camss/Kconfig b/drivers/media/platform/qcom/camss/Kconfig new file mode 100644 index 000000000000..56be91578706 --- /dev/null +++ b/drivers/media/platform/qcom/camss/Kconfig @@ -0,0 +1,9 @@ +config VIDEO_QCOM_CAMSS + tristate "Qualcomm V4L2 Camera Subsystem driver" + depends on V4L_PLATFORM_DRIVERS + depends on VIDEO_V4L2 + depends on (ARCH_QCOM && IOMMU_DMA) || COMPILE_TEST + select MEDIA_CONTROLLER + select VIDEO_V4L2_SUBDEV_API + select VIDEOBUF2_DMA_SG + select V4L2_FWNODE